Webb1 juli 2005 · Computed tomography (CT) plays an important role in diagnosis of acute intestinal obstruction and planning of surgical treatment. Although internal hernias are uncommon, they may be included in the differential diagnosis in cases of intestinal obstruction, especially in the absence of a history of abdominal surgery or trauma.
